Mixed Effects Meta-Analysis with Stochastic Conditional Variances
- Michelle Mitchell
University of California, Merced - Jack Vevea
University of California, Merced
Abstract
This study is to introduces a new “stochastic method” for analysis in mixed-effects meta-analysis. Using simulation, we compare the performance of this new method with conventional methods of estimation for two types of effect size measures. Results indicate that the under certain conditions this new method outperforms the conventional approach.
